Routinely requested questions What time of 12 months really should Luffa seeds be planted? The Luffa seeds need to be planted after the Hazard of the frost has handed. They can be started indoors several weeks ahead of the final frost. How must Luffa seeds be planted? The Luffa seeds ought to be immediate sown at one/two-inch depth and spaced 24 inches aside. Soak the seeds in a very cup of drinking water 12-24 hrs just before planting.

Buying seedlings or starter vegetation may well jump-start moss roses’ flowering interval, Nonetheless they may also be developed from seeds or propagated as a result of cuttings from recognized plants. 

Drinking water lightly and retain moist until finally new advancement appears (a sign the plant is established). Moss rose’s shallow root program ensures that water is very important right until plants get heading. Afterward, too much drinking water could potentially cause rot, Which explains why perfectly-draining soil is vital.
